Evacuation lifted near Reno County gas plant rocked by blast

KMIZ

HAVEN, Kan. (AP) — Authorities are allowing people to return to their homes near a Reno County gas plant a day after an explosion rocked the plant and led to a fire there. Television station KSN reports that officials lifted the evacuation order Friday morning after about 90 people were evacuated Thursday and sent to hotels for the night. Fire and emergency management crews were called to the Haven Midstream plant Thursday afternoon for an explosion and fire. Two people suffered minor injuries and were taken to a Wichita hospital. Residents within a 2-mile radius of the plant were evacuated following the explosion. The plant is located near Haven, which is about 33 miles northwest of Wichita. Kansas Highway 96 near the plant was also closed by has since mostly reopened.
